Amarjeet Singh And Others vs State Of U P And Others

High Court Of Judicature at Allahabad|31 October, 2018
|

JUDGMENT / ORDER

Court No. - 40
Case :- WRIT - C No. - 36343 of 2018 Petitioner :- Amarjeet Singh And 2 Others Respondent :- State Of U.P. And 3 Others Counsel for Petitioner :- Ajay Kumar Singh,Ashish Kumar Singh Counsel for Respondent :- C.S.C.,Ashok Kumar Pandey
Hon'ble Amreshwar Pratap Sahi,J. Hon'ble Ajit Kumar,J.
Heard learned counsel for the petitioners.
The map for construction was filed before the Meerut Development Authority and according to the orders on record, the said map was under the deemed sanctioned category. However, the cancellation thereof has been communicated vide letter dated 05.06.2018.
It appears that the petitioners on their own approached the Secretary of the Development Authority and 05.07.2018 was fixed for hearing. Another communication was sent to the petitioners on 18.07.2018 to the effect that since they have failed to appear, therefore, the previous communication and order for cancellation has been maintained. It appears that the petitioners again approached the development authority whereupon vide letter dated 20.08.2018 another date i.e. 28.8.2018 was fixed for the hearing of the matter.
From the record it appears that the allegation against the petitioners is that they had obtained the sanction of the map by concealing or withholding certain facts. Learned counsel contends that the cancellation order could not have been passed without giving notice or opportunity in terms of Section 15(9) read with the proviso there to of the U.P. Urban Planning and Development Act, 1973. Learned counsel for the petitioners submits that the original cancellation order was not provided to the petitioners and there is nothing on record that prior to cancellation any notice had been issued. Even otherwise the attempts made by the petitioners to get a rehearing has failed and no orders according to the petitioners has been passed till date.
There is nothing on record to indicate as to what happened on 28.08.2018 which was the date fixed before the Development Authority.
In this view of the matter, we dispose off this writ petition with a direction that the petitioners shall file a certified copy of this order before the Development Authority and the concerned officer shall proceed to pass appropriate orders if not already passed in relation to the said claim of the petitioners after considering the nature of the objections raised by the petitioners as well as facts relating to and the explanation given by the petitioners.
The writ petition stands disposed off with the aforesaid directions. The order shall be passed preferably within six weeks from the date of production of a certified copy of the order before the Secretary, Respondent No.3.
Order Date :- 31.10.2018 saqlain
